Description

Chlorotitanium Triisopropoxide is a versatile organotitanium compound that serves as a crucial precursor and catalyst in advanced material synthesis. Its value lies in its ability to introduce both titanium and chlorine functionalities under mild conditions, enabling precise control over reaction pathways and material properties. This chemical is essential for researchers and manufacturers in the pharmaceutical, specialty polymer, and advanced ceramics sectors who require high-purity intermediates for sophisticated synthesis.

Application

  • Catalyst in Organic Synthesis: Acts as a Lewis acid catalyst for key transformations like esterification, transesterification, and Diels-Alder reactions.
  • Precursor for Sol-Gel Processes: Used in the production of high-purity titanium dioxide (TiO₂) films, coatings, and nanoparticles for optical and electronic applications.
  • Polymerization Catalyst/Co-catalyst: Employed in Ziegler-Natta type systems for the polymerization of olefins and the synthesis of specialty polymers.
  • Surface Modification Agent: Functionalizes inorganic surfaces (e.g., silica, glass) with titanium alkoxide groups to alter adhesion and compatibility properties.
  • Chemical Vapor Deposition (CVD): Serves as a volatile source for depositing titanium-containing thin films on semiconductors and other substrates.
  • Pharmaceutical Intermediate: Used in the synthesis of complex organic molecules and active pharmaceutical ingredients (APIs) where titanium-mediated steps are required.

Basic Information

Product Name Chlorotitanium Triisopropoxide
CAS No. 20717-86-6
Molecular Formula C₉H₂₁ClO₃Ti
Molecular Weight 260.60 g/mol
Synonyms Titanium(IV) Chloride Triisopropoxide; Chlorotriisopropoxytitanium; Isopropyl Alcohol, Titanium(4+) Chloride Salt; Triisopropoxytitanium Chloride; Titanium Chloride Triisopropoxide; TiCl(O-i-Pr)₃; Chlorotris(isopropoxy)titanium

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at room temperature (15-25°C). This material is hygroscopic (moisture-sensitive) and must be handled under an inert atmosphere (e.g., nitrogen or argon) to prevent decomposition. Keep away from heat, sparks, and open flame.

Specification

Item Specification
Appearance Colorless to pale yellow liquid
Identification (IR) Conforms
Assay (Titration) ≥ 95.0%
Chloride Content Conforms
Isopropanol Content (GC) ≤ 2.0%
Density (at 20°C) ~1.0 g/cm³
